Not only did they fix it, the "new" Midnight Blue (introduced in 2006) is an amazing color IMHO. It doesn't have that purple hue that the "old" Mid Blue had, it's also sightly darker and less metallic. If I were to order a new 4003, I know my choice of color would definitely be Midnight Blue.
